According to WiseGuy Reports, the Semiconductor Equipment Semiconductor Packaging Equipment Market Forecast indicates that the industry will increase from USD 56.4 billion in 2024 and USD 60.4 billion in 2025 to USD 120.0 billion by 2035, advancing at a CAGR of 7.1%. Market expansion is supported by technological advancements, increasing semiconductor miniaturization, widespread IoT adoption, growth of electric vehicles, expanding AI applications, and continuous innovation in semiconductor packaging materials. Key companies include Tokyo Electron, Advantest, Lam Research, Teradyne, KLA Corporation, National Instruments, Applied Materials, Brooks Automation, SUSS MicroTec, Screen Holdings, Rudolph Technologies, Cohu, Yokogawa Electric, HITACHI High-Technologies, ASML, and Nissin Electronics.

Regional Analysis
Asia Pacific is expected to remain the dominant regional market due to its extensive semiconductor manufacturing ecosystem across China, Taiwan, Japan, South Korea, Malaysia, and other regional economies. Strong government support, advanced fabrication facilities, and expanding electronics production continue driving equipment demand.
North America maintains a significant position through semiconductor innovation, research investments, and expansion of domestic manufacturing capacity. Europe continues strengthening its semiconductor ecosystem through investments in automotive electronics, industrial automation, and advanced manufacturing technologies.
South America and the Middle East & Africa are expected to experience gradual growth as semiconductor applications continue expanding across industrial and consumer sectors.
